Pathoschild / SMAPI

The modding API for Stardew Valley.
https://smapi.io/
GNU Lesser General Public License v3.0
1.82k stars 259 forks source link

Mod update checks fail if one mod has invalid version #462

Closed Pathoschild closed 6 years ago

Pathoschild commented 6 years ago

Update checks fail if a mod has an invalid version:

[WARN SMAPI] Couldn't check for new mod versions. This won't affect your game, but you won't be notified of mod updates if this keeps happening.
[DEBUG SMAPI] System.FormatException: The input '1.6.8h' isn't a valid semantic version.
    at StardewModdingAPI.Common.SemanticVersionImpl..ctor(String version) in C:\source\_Stardew\SMAPI\src\SMAPI.Common\SemanticVersionImpl.cs:line 78
    at StardewModdingAPI.SemanticVersion..ctor(String version) in C:\source\_Stardew\SMAPI\src\SMAPI\SemanticVersion.cs:line 50
    at StardewModdingAPI.Program.<>c__DisplayClass26_0.<CheckForUpdatesAsync>b__0() in C:\source\_Stardew\SMAPI\src\SMAPI\Program.cs:line 632

See:

Pathoschild commented 6 years ago

Fixed in develop for the upcoming SMAPI 2.5.5.